Talking Best Mastercam x5 Beginners guide/book?

I have Mastercam X5. I model everything in in solid works 2010. I have a large 3 axis mill/router. What are my best options for instruction? I would like a quality book that includes some basic tutorials to get me up and running. Cutting out simple 2D shapes, and simple 3D shapes. I like to import my solid works files directly into it. Most of the stuff i want to do is flat sheet and not very complicated. The controller for the mill will be Mach 3.

It has Mill level 3 and Router level 3.

You should go with video tutorial.

They're very good website that sell them.

Much better for learning.

I bought a lot of books about Mastercam almost all available.

The problem is that they almost all use the same project from book to book.

Tips For Manufacturing Multimedia Training Tools For Mastercam and Anilam is one of the best.

But look for other, You Tube has a lot of good video.
